Development of microwave assisted spectrophotometric method for the determination of glucose
Asif Ali1, Zahid Hussain1, Muhammad Balal Arain1
1Department of Chemistry, Abdul Wali Khan University Mardan, Mardan 23200, Pakistan.
Abstract:
A spectrophotometric method was developed based on the microwave assisted synthesis of Maillard product. Various conditions of the reaction were optimized by varying the relative concentration of the reagents, operating temperature and volume of solutions used in the reaction in the microwave synthesizer. The absorbance of the microwave synthesized Maillard product was measured in the range of 360-740 nm using UV-Visible spectrophotometer. Based on the maximum absorbance, 370 nm was selected as the optimum wave length for further studies. The LOD and LOQ of glucose was found 3.08 μg mL(-1) and 9.33 μg mL(-1) with standard deviation of ±0.05. The developed method was also applicable to urine sample.
